Kingdom of Cambodia

What do I believe foreign people know and think about Cambodia?

Cambodia is the country in Southeast Asia which have 181.035 kilo meter square. It has 1 capital city and 23 provinces. Cambodia have 14.805.000 people (estimate in 2010). The monarch in Cambodia is Norodom Sihamoni and the prime minister is Hun Sen. In Cambodia the most amazing place is Angkor Wat temple in Siem Reap that make a lot of foriegn people and local people come to visit it. It made by Suryavarman II in the early 12th century as his state temple and capital city.
